All the Montauk line trains are double-deckers -- they're the only trains (AFAIK) with Diesel engines, and the tracks past Babylon are not electrified.
Other than a very select few that go into Penn Station, you'd probably need to catch one at Jamaica. On a weekend, looks like you could, for example, take an 9:45a or 11:45am from Penn, and change in Jamaica to the 10:10a/12:10p to Montauk, and get out at Babylon (from which there should be a good number of options to return, though most won't be double-deckers).
Also from Jamaica, the 2:41p to Speonk or 5:41p to Patchogue.
